What is Business Insurance?
Business insurance is a broad term covering multiple types of policies that protect entrepreneurs, owners, and employees from financial risks.
It includes liability protection, infrastructure safety, staff insurance, and more.
Common Types of Commercial Insurance in Santa Rosa CA:
- Third-Party Risk Coverage – Protects against third-party claims of customer injuries, equipment destruction, or legal costs.
- Commercial Property Insurance – Covers business property like storefronts, stock, and equipment from accidental damage, theft, or catastrophic incidents.
- All-in-One Business Protection – A bundled policy combining general liability and property insurance at a discounted rate.
- Staff Injury Policy – Covers doctor visits and financial support for workers injured on the job.
- Malpractice Coverage – Protects against disputes of faulty advice or errors in client interactions.
- Corporate Car Policy – Covers company cars used for commercial use.
- Digital Security Coverage – Protects against data breaches, online fraud, and cyber threats.
How Much Does warehouse insurance in Santa Rosa CA Cost?
The cost of commercial insurance varies based on factors such as:
- Sector – Fields with high accident rates (contracting, trucking) pay more than administrative companies (advisory, hospitality).
- Operating Region – Regional policies, crime rates, and natural disaster probability can affect pricing.
- Workforce Size – Increased income and larger workforce mean expanded liability.

How to Choose the Right Commercial Insurance Policy
- Identify Potential Threats – Identify frequent risks in your business field and state.
- Evaluate Coverage Options – Get multiple quotes from leading providers.
- Understand Policy Terms – Ensure you fully understand coverage limits, non-covered scenarios, and deductibles.
- Optimize Your Coverage – Comprehensive Insurance Packages can save money compared to purchasing separate policies.
- Work with an Agent – A experienced consultant can tailor a policy to your specific needs.
